Cool 1920s Spanish house updated with a touch of class to accommodate today's lifestyle, old-fashioned in all the right places, modern where you need it. With tons of charm and character, this home is shaded by iconic 100-year old California oak trees.. Hardwood floors and custom tile throughout. 3 bedrooms (king, queen and twins) each bedroom with a walk-in closet. 2 full baths. Fully furnished living room with reclining sofa, big screen smart TV, and fireplace. The dining room features a wild edge dining table with seating for 8 and French doors that open to catch the ocean breezes. The fully equipped modern kitchen has stainless appliances and a 50's diner themed breakfast nook. Enjoy a Sunday al fresco brunch, BBQ or 5 o'clock happy hour around the patio table on the terra cotta-paved deck, or kick back in the Adirondak-style easy chairs. The laundry room is equipped with full-size washer and dryer. The 2-car garage is accessible through a private back entrance. Bring your bicycles and pedal the half-mile or so to the bike path along the beach. Well-located within walking and bicycle distance to Downtown and Midtown amenities including theaters, parks, the beach, restaurants and the Downtown walk-street shopping area. No smoking. High speed internet and DirecTV (187 channels with almost all sports networks) with HBO and Showtime. We're okay with most pets. Ventura STVR Permit#2447
